Why Dental Care is vital for Mini Dachshunds
Suitable dental care isn’t just about preventing poor breath—it’s important for the Mini Dachshund’s General health and fitness. In this article’s why:
one. Prevents Dental Diseases
Mini Dachshunds are liable to dental complications like tartar buildup, gum disorder, and tooth decay. With no typical treatment, these troubles can result in pain, tooth reduction, or perhaps bacterial infections.
2. Shields Their Internal Organs
Untreated dental ailment could cause bacteria to enter your Puppy dog’s bloodstream, perhaps influencing their heart, kidneys, and liver.
3. Enhances Standard of living
Wholesome tooth and gums enable it to be less complicated for your Mini Dachshund to consume, Enjoy, and luxuriate in lifestyle devoid of irritation.
four. Minimizes Vet Charges
Preventative dental care is a great deal more cost-effective than dealing with State-of-the-art dental diseases or carrying out tooth extractions.
Frequent Dental Concerns in Mini Dachshund Puppies
Ahead of diving into tricks for holding your Dog’s tooth healthier, it’s crucial to be aware of the widespread dental troubles Mini Dachshunds experience:
1. Tartar and Plaque Buildup
Plaque sorts on your own Pet’s teeth soon after ingesting, and if not removed, it hardens into tartar. This may lead to gum discomfort and infections.
2. Gum Disease (Periodontal Disorder)
Inflamed gums are an early indicator of periodontal disease. If still left untreated, this situation can cause gum recession, agony, and tooth loss.
3. Retained Newborn Enamel
Mini Dachshund puppies may possibly occasionally retain their toddler teeth, which can cause overcrowding or misaligned teeth.
4. Negative Breath (Halitosis)
Persistent negative breath is often a sign of underlying dental troubles, such as tartar buildup or gum ailment.
five. Tooth Fractures
Mini Dachshunds like to chew, but biting on hard objects can cause chipped or fractured tooth.
Tips on how to Keep the Mini Dachshund Puppy dog’s Enamel Balanced
Caring for your Mini Dachshund’s enamel doesn’t have to be complex. By subsequent the following tips, it is possible to guarantee your Pet’s dental overall health is in wonderful form:
one. Brush Their Tooth Routinely
Brushing your Pup’s enamel is The easiest method to stop plaque and tartar buildup.
How you can Brush Your Mini Dachshund’s Enamel
1) Utilize a Puppy-particular toothbrush and toothpaste (never use human toothpaste).
2) Start by allowing your puppy sniff and style the toothpaste to obtain them snug.
3) Gently carry their lips and brush in tiny, round motions.
four) Target the outer surfaces of the tooth, in which plaque tends to build up.
five) Brush two–3 instances each week for the top results.
2. Supply Dental Chews
Dental chews absolutely are a practical way that will help thoroughly clean your Mini Dachshund’s teeth even though holding them entertained.
>> Select Vet-Permitted Chews: Try to look for chews Using the Veterinary Oral Overall health Council (VOHC) seal of approval.
>> Keep an eye on Chewing: Generally supervise your Dog to be sure they don’t swallow significant items on the chew.
3. Supply Chew Toys
Chew toys aid get rid of plaque and massage your Puppy dog’s gums.
>> What to search for: Decide on toys fabricated from resilient, non-toxic materials suitable for smaller puppies.
>> Stay away from Difficult Objects: Keep away from bones or challenging toys that might fracture your puppy’s tooth.
four. Feed a Dental-Pleasant Food plan
Some dog foods are formulated to advertise dental well being by lessening plaque and tartar buildup.
>> Dry Foodstuff: Kibble can help scrape plaque off your Pet’s enamel as they chew.
>> Dental-Precise Formulation: Request your vet about prescription meal plans made for oral health and fitness.
five. Use Dental Water Additives
Dental water additives are a straightforward solution to boost your Dog’s oral hygiene. Simply just add them to their drinking water to aid lessen plaque and freshen their breath.
six. Schedule Typical Vet Checkups
Your veterinarian plays a crucial part in keeping your Mini Dachshund’s dental wellbeing.
>> Dog Checkups: All through regular visits, your vet will look for retained baby enamel, gum health and fitness, and early indications of dental ailment.
>> Specialist Cleanings: Plan annual dental cleanings to eliminate tartar and tackle any underlying issues.
seven. Watch for Warning Signals
Continue to keep an eye fixed out for signs that the puppy might need a dental challenge, for example:
>> Poor breath
>> Pink or swollen gums
>> Trouble consuming or chewing
>> Yellow or brown tartar buildup
Unfastened or lacking teeth
For those who observe any of such indicators, consult your vet quickly.

1) How often must I brush my Mini Dachshund Pet’s teeth?
Aim to brush your puppy’s enamel at least two–3 instances per week. Every day brushing is ideal for exceptional dental health and fitness.
two) Can I use human toothpaste for my Mini Dachshund?
No, human toothpaste contains substances which have been poisonous to canines. Usually use dog-unique toothpaste.
3) Exactly what are the top chew toys for Mini Dachshund puppies?
Try to find soft, long lasting toys exclusively designed for smaller breeds. Stay away from hard toys or bones that would fracture their teeth
4) How do I am aware if my Mini Dachshund has gum illness?
Signs of gum sickness contain purple or swollen gums, bad breath, and issues chewing. Frequent vet checkups will help catch gum disorder early.
